Abstract

The invention relates to a gear rack fixture of a spline cold extrusion press. The gear rack fixture comprises two fixed bases (1) which are correspondingly matched, wherein each fixed base (1) is provided with two wedge-shaped blocks (2) which are correspondingly matched; each fixed base is respectively connected with a gear rack (3); the gear racks (3) are arranged on the corresponding wedge-shaped blocks (2). The gear rack fixture is characterized in that connection cushion blocks (4) are matched and connected between the corresponding wedge-shaped blocks (2) and the gear racks (3). The gear rack fixture has the advantages that a fixture on a spline gear rolling machine is changed, when splines with the same modulus and different tooth numbers are produced, the same spline gear racks can be used for processing, so that the generality of the gear racks is enhanced, the labor intensity is reduced, the tool replacement time is saved, and the equipment cost is lowered.

Background technology
Spline cold extrusion press is the usual means of present stage for the production of spline, and it utilizes tooth bar opposing upper and lower to process workpiece.Multiple spline gear rolling is that part rotates between the tooth bar of motion in the opposite direction by the metal of part edge being carried out to a kind of processing technology of continuous profiled.Tooth bar adopts particular design, and each tooth is deeply penetrated in part step by step by the slope section of tooth bar, and then, in the polishing section of tooth bar, part guarantees size and fineness by rotating a few.
Present stage is while being used spline cold extrusion press to process the different numbers of teeth and modulus spline, need to change different tooth bars, its versatility is poor, and the size of tooth bar is long, and weight is large, the labour intensity of changing tooth bar is large, the adjustment time is long, and the manufacturing cost of tooth bar is very large, through extensively retrieval, not yet find comparatively desirable technical scheme.

The specific embodiment
As shown in Figure 1, the tooth bar frock of a kind of spline cold extrusion press provided by the invention, comprise the holder 1 of two corresponding matching, be symmetrical arranged two location-plate 1a in the both sides of each holder 1, be provided with a baffle plate 1b in the upper end of each location-plate, on each holder 1, be provided with two corresponding matching wedge shapes fast 2, fast 2 sides of wedge shape contact cooperation with corresponding location-plate 1a respectively, on location-plate 1a, be also connected with micrometer adjusting screw 8, micrometer adjusting screw 8 coordinates with the contacts side surfaces of wedge shape fast 2 below, on each holder 1, also connect respectively a tooth bar 3, the fixed head 3a of tooth bar both sides respectively with corresponding baffle plate 1b corresponding matching, each tooth bar 3 is all arranged in corresponding wedge shape fast 2, on each baffle plate 1b, be provided with a hold-down bolt 7, hold-down bolt 7 and fixed head 3a compression fit, on a baffle plate 1b, also connect bolt 6 therein, bolt 6 coordinates with one of them location, side of tooth bar 3, each tooth bar 3 is fixed on holder by connecting bolt 9 again, it is characterized in that: square cushion block 4 is connected between corresponding wedge shape fast 2 and tooth bar 3, wherein two relative sides of cushion block contact cooperation with corresponding location-plate 1a respectively, in the time producing the different number of teeth, square adjustment block 5 also can also be connected between tooth bar 3 and location-plate 1a, adjustment block is arranged on the another side of the tooth bar relative with bolt 63.
Identical at processing modulus, when the different spline of the number of teeth, use same set of moulding tooth bar, must measure them, to obtain the thickness H of cushion block.During according to machine tooling spline, regulate the computing formula of upper and lower tooth bar position: RDLO=2 × (SED+H)+φ D to calculate thickness H=(RDLO-φ D of cushion block)/2-SED,
Wherein, SED---the size of tooth bar initiating terminal; The upper and lower opening spacing of RDLO---machine is 6 inches; The diameter of φ D---part before spline moulding; The thickness of H---cushion block.
Adjustment block thickness is determined: check the corresponding product drawing of part, by Parameter of spline, obtain the maximum effectively transverse tooth thickness L of spline 1in the minimum actual transverse tooth thickness L of spline 2, side is adjusted pad thickness L=(L 1+ L 2)/2.
If change even number tooth into by odd number tooth, can there is displacement in the first profile of tooth that upper and lower tooth bar cold extrusion forms, and therefore increases this side adjustment cushion block and form first displacement of holding this profile of tooth.If when the number of teeth is always odd number tooth or even number tooth, does not need to increase this side and adjust cushion block.In order to guarantee after spline moulding, the problem that spline does not misplace, side is adjusted cushion block thickness deviation must be controlled at [+(L 1+ L 2)/2 ,-(L 1+ L 2)/2].
